Evaluating the Accuracy of Molecular Diagnostic Testing for Canine Visceral Leishmaniasis Using Latent Class Analysis

TL;DR: Evaluating the accuracy of molecular diagnostic testing in dogs from an endemic area for canine visceral leishmaniasis (CVL) by determining which tissue type provided the highest rate of parasite DNA detection confirmed that the splenic aspirate is the most effective type of tissue for detecting L. infantum infection.
